Assembly Resolution No. 545

BY: M. of A. Rajkumar

        RECOGNIZING  July  23,  2023, as Egyptian Heritage
        Day in the State of New York

  WHEREAS, It is the sense of this Legislative Body to  recognize  and
pay  just  tribute  to  the cultural heritage of the ethnic groups which
comprise and contribute to the richness and diversity of  the  community
of the State of New York; and

  WHEREAS,  Attendant  to  such  concern,  and  in  keeping  with  its
time-honored traditions, it is the intent of this  Legislative  Body  to
recognize  July  23,  2023, as Egyptian Heritage Day in the State of New
York; and

  WHEREAS, The Arab Republic of Egypt is a great ally of our State and
Nation, sharing deep economic, social, and cultural ties; and

  WHEREAS, Egypt is the second-largest recipient of  American  foreign
aid,  representing  our Nation's profound appreciation of our diplomatic
relationship; and

  WHEREAS, The friendly relationship between  the  United  States  and
Egypt  is  visible in New York City, home to the Temple of Dendur at the
Metropolitan Museum of Art, and Cleopatra's Needle in Central Park, both
gifts from the Egyptian government; and

  WHEREAS,  The  United  States  is  home  to  over  250,000  Egyptian
Americans,  who  constitute  the  largest Arab American community in our
Nation, and make  immeasurable  contributions  to  the  arts,  the  STEM
fields,  business,  philanthropy,  academics, defense, sports, religion,
and government; and

  WHEREAS, Over 30,000 Egyptian Americans live  in  our  Great  State,
residing  predominantly  in  New  York  City,  where  they  have left an
indelible imprint on every facet of life; and

  WHEREAS, The heart of New York's Egyptian American community is  the
beloved  neighborhood  of  Little  Egypt  in  Astoria,  home to thriving
businesses, including vibrant restaurants and hookah lounges; and

  WHEREAS, In appreciation of  the  Egyptian  American  community,  in
2023,  New  York City co-named Steinway Street between Astoria Boulevard
and 28th Avenue as "Little Egypt"; and

  WHEREAS, This Legislative Body is pleased to have  this  opportunity
to  recognize  such events of significance which foster ethnic pride and
exemplify the cultural diversity that  represents  and  strengthens  the
fabric of the people and the State of New York; now, therefore, be it

  RESOLVED,  That  this Legislative Body pause in its deliberations to
recognize July 23, 2023, as Egyptian Heritage Day in the  State  of  New
York; and be it further

  RESOLVED,  That  copies  of  this Resolution, suitably engrossed, be
transmitted to  the  Consul  General  of  Egypt,  and  various  Egyptian
organizations in the State of New York.
